Accessible ramp construction services involve designing and building ramps that provide safe, stable, and convenient access to homes and other properties. These ramps are typically constructed using durable materials such as concrete, wood, or metal, and are tailored to meet the specific needs of each property. The process often includes assessing the property’s layout, ensuring the ramp slope complies with accessibility standards, and integrating features like handrails or non-slip surfaces for added safety. This service helps create a smooth transition between different levels, making it easier for individuals with mobility challenges to enter and exit a building comfortably.
Many common problems are addressed through accessible ramp construction. For homeowners with mobility impairments, stairs can become a significant obstacle, especially if they use wheelchairs, walkers, or have difficulty climbing steps. Temporary issues such as recovering from surgery or injury can also make stairs unsafe or impossible to navigate. Additionally, properties with uneven terrain or steps at entrances can pose hazards for elderly residents or visitors with limited mobility. Building a ramp provides a practical solution, reducing the risk of falls and making daily activities more manageable for residents and visitors alike.

The overview below groups typical Accessible Ramp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Palmdale,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ine ramp repairs or modifications in Palmdale range from $250 to $600. Many minor projects f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and materials needed.
Standard Ramp Installations - Installing a new accessible ramp us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more complex projects can reach up to $5,000 or more, especially if custom features or permits are required.
Full Ramp Replacement - Replacing an existing ramp with a new structure often falls between $3,500 and $7,000. Fewer projects push into the higher end of this range, which can include extensive site work or specialized design elements.
Custom or Complex Projects - Highly customized ramps or multi-level installations can exceed $10,000, depending on size, materials, and site conditions. Such projects are less common but may be necessary for unique accessibility need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ential to a smooth project process.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als or work descriptions that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and any responsibilities on both sides. Having these details documented hel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. Reputable local contractors are typically transparent about their process and willing to provide written estimates or agreements, which serve as a foundation for a successful collaboration.
